Nicole Maines Gets “Bit” July 26
You may know actress Nicole Maines for her role on the most recent season of Supergirl, but in a new indie film making its debut soon at Outfest Los Angeles, she’ll be encountering supernatural phenomena of a different kind.
In the new movie “Bit” Maines plays Laurel, a small town trans teen who’s just moved to LA to find a new life. Little does she know the life she’ll find is somewhat different that expected….she meets and befriends a group of punk girls who turn out to be vampires. Laurel isn’t sure of their true intentions, but having come from a town where she was never accepted, she’s open to giving them a chance.
Only problem is, the leader of the pack attacked and bit her when they first met. She is very probably turning into a vampire herself, and it’s their fault. Does she really have a choice in joining them?
In addition to Maines, “Bit” co-stars Diana Hopper (“Goliath”), James Paxton (Boogeyman Pop, “Eyewitness”), Zolee Griggs (“Wu-Tang: An American Saga”), Friday Chamberlain, Char Diaz, Greg Hill (Operation Finale) and M.C. Gainey (Con Air). It was written and directed by Brad Michael Elmore, and produced by Robert Reed Peterson, Nicholas Cafritz, Peter Winther, Louis Steyn and T.J. Steyn.
“Bit” will have its world premiere at the TCL Chinese Theater in LA July 26. Future release plans from there have yet to be announced.
